From a 2x2 contingency table, which pairing gives the number of people with the condition?

Explanation:
In a diagnostic 2x2 table, to know how many people actually have the condition, add those who truly have it regardless of their test result. True positives are people who test positive and do have the condition, while false negatives are people who have the condition but test negative. Adding these two groups gives the total number of individuals with the condition. The other pairings don’t represent those with the condition: false positives and true negatives are people without the condition, true positives plus true negatives are all correct test outcomes, and false positives plus false negatives are all incorrect test outcomes. So the correct pairing is true positives and false negatives.
